Manager, Employment Brand

We are seeking a creative, analytical and results oriented Employment Brand Manager to manage, lead and grow the activation of our employment brand to drive the attraction of top talent to Rogers. Reporting to the Senior Manager, Talent Acquisition Strategy and Programs, you will focus on expanding the company's online presence on different employment sites, identifying new recruitment opportunities through social media, and developing creative ways to attract the best diverse talent by partnering with the Talent Acquisition and Brand/Communications teams.

What you will do:
  • Build and deliver the strategy and content on segmented Employee Value Proposition (EVP) campaigns that expresses our EVP in a way that inspires action for our targeted talent segments
  • Gather market intelligence on industry and competitor trends and incorporate this into effective recruitment or sourcing strategies.
  • Manage recruitment vendors and employer profiles and branding (LinkedIn, Glassdoor, Indeed, Job Boards)
  • Report and analyze employment brand KPIs to determine effectiveness of internal/external employment branding
  • Engage internal departments in helping to curate and create employment branding content that is on-brand and reflects and supports our culture
  • Embed EVP into content, resources, and programs and collaborating across departments to embed in training programs and other employee programs
  • Create and manage a social media strategy and content calendar focused on career-related content
  • Solicit and assemble content updates from across the organization in order to update existing properties, including jobs.rogers.com

What you bring to the role:

  • 3-5 years of relevant experience in the areas of strategic branding, recruitment marketing, sourcing and networking
  • Experience in effective and innovative techniques for identifying new talent including: Talent campaigns, internet searches, job board, SEO and social media
  • Proficiency with digital job boards, social media trends and associated best practices
  • Experience using an Applicant Tracking System is a requirement. Experience with Success Factors would be an asset
  • Superior organizational and planning skills, with an ability to identify risks and manage expectations
  • Detail-oriented and highly meticulous, even when faced with competing priorities in a deadline driven environment
  • Proven analytical and intermediate/advanced excel skills
  • Strong oral and written communication skills
  • Bilingual French-English an asset
